WebSep 9, 2024 · The arrowwood type is an excellent choice for shade. These flowering shrubs bloom with clusters of flowers in spring, and they produce both red fall foliage and blue berries in fall. WebApr 14, 2024 · For patio or terrace gardening, use a trellis or screen of native shrubs such as juniper or viburnum to help shield plants from the wind. Native plants tend to need less water, which is ideal for balcony gardening. To save space, herbs such as thyme and oregano can be planted around potted shrubs and trees to act as mulch.

Fagus Sylvatica ‘Dawyck Green is a great alternative to the more commonly planted fastigiated oaks and hornbeams. It originated from Scotland circa 1850. A beautiful medium sized deciduous tree (15-20m) with a columnar form, which rarely exceeds more than 3 metres width.
